Fairness for All: Affordable Legal Assistance in Pakistan

Pakistan's juridical system, while striving for fairness before the law, often leaves vulnerable populations behind. The path to equitable treatment can be incredibly challenging, particularly for those lacking economic resources and awareness. A significant obstacle is the constrained availability of pro bono legal assistance, hindering access to defense for countless individuals facing petty criminal charges, family disputes, or land conflicts. Numerous non-governmental organizations and dedicated lawyers are working to bridge this shortfall by offering essential advice and legal defense, but much more needs to be done to ensure genuine equitable treatment is attained for all citizens, irrespective of their socioeconomic position. Greater government funding and public awareness campaigns are crucial to fostering a more just and comprehensive legal landscape throughout Pakistan.
